在当今数字化时代,APP已成为企业连接用户、提升品牌影响力的关键工具。然而,APP软件定制开发的费用却成为许多企业关注的焦点。本文将全面解析APP软件定制开发的费用构成,帮助您做出合理的预算规划。
一、功能复杂度决定价格基础
APP的功能复杂度是影响开发费用的最主要因素。根据功能的不同,APP可以分为基础版、中等功能版和高端定制版。
-
基础版:这类APP通常具备简单的信息展示和基本互动功能,如企业展示APP。其开发费用相对较低,大约在1万元至3万元之间。开发周期较短,一般一个月内即可完成。
-
中等功能版:包含用户注册、支付功能、消息推送等更多特色功能的APP,其开发费用会相应提升,大约在3万元至10万元之间。这类APP常见于电商类平台或有社交功能的资讯软件,开发周期大约需要2至3个月。
-
高端定制版:对于涉及复杂社交功能、大数据处理、实时同步等高度定制化需求的APP,其开发费用通常会超过10万元,甚至高达数百万元。这类APP的开发周期较长,可能需要3至6个月或更长时间。
二、开发方式影响成本
除了功能复杂度外,开发方式也是决定APP开发费用的重要因素。目前,市场上主要有原生开发、混合开发和低代码/无代码开发三种方式。
-
原生开发:原生APP具有出色的性能和用户体验,适合需求高、用户体验要求高的项目。然而,其开发成本也相对较高,因为需要针对不同平台(iOS和Android)分别开发。
-
混合开发:混合APP利用跨平台框架(如React Native、Flutter等)同时适配iOS和Android,降低了开发成本。虽然性能略逊于原生APP,但开发周期更短,适合预算有限、功能不太复杂的应用。
-
低代码/无代码开发:利用低代码平台或工具,企业可以快速构建简单的APP,大大降低了开发成本。这种方式适合需要快速上线、功能相对单一的应用。
三、团队选择决定效率与质量
开发团队的选择同样对APP开发费用产生重要影响。小型团队(2-3人)可能价格较低,但开发周期长、更新慢;而大型公司(拥有完整开发、测试、UI设计团队)则效率更高,价格自然也更高。此外,国内开发团队相比欧美和日本,劳动力成本较低,也是影响费用的一个因素。
四、后续维护不可忽视
APP开发完成后,后续维护同样重要。这包括BUG修复、功能迭代、性能优化等。通常,第一年内的维护费用占总开发成本的15%-20%。因此,在预算规划时,务必考虑后续维护费用。
五、案例分析
为了更好地理解APP软件定制开发的费用,以下提供两个案例分析:
-
案例一:一家餐饮店想开发一个点餐APP,采用低代码开发方式,预算在5万元至10万元之间。开发周期较短,一个月内即可完成。该APP具备简单的点餐、支付和订单管理功能。
-
案例二:一家金融企业希望开发一款高度定制化的APP,涉及人工智能、实时通信和大数据分析等功能。采用原生开发方式,预算超过50万元。开发周期长达6个月,需要一支完整的团队进行长期开发和维护。
六、如何合理规划预算
在规划APP软件定制开发预算时,企业应综合考虑功能需求、开发方式、团队选择以及后续维护等因素。建议与多家开发团队详细讨论项目细节,获取报价,并考察团队的专业水平、过往作品和客户评价。同时,预留一定比例的预算应对意外情况,如需求变更、技术难题等。
总之,APP软件定制开发的费用是一个复杂的问题,涉及多个因素。通过深入了解这些因素,企业可以做出合理的预算规划,确保项目顺利进行并取得预期效果。